Background
The commutator is widely applied to motors and electric tool products, and the basic structure of the commutator is as follows: the commutator is divided into a plane commutator, a groove commutator and a hook commutator, and mainly comprises an insulating base body and commutator segments distributed on the circumferential surface of the base body, wherein an insulating groove is arranged between adjacent commutator segments to separate and insulate each commutator segment, and one end bending part of each commutator segment is used for wiring.
But can make whole commutator unable normal work when the commutator segment breaks down, because under high-power high-speed operation, the commutator segment receives stronger centrifugal force to temperature under high-speed operation is higher, the inside of commutator is easily by the extrusion deformation, if the functioning speed is very fast moreover, the phenomenon that inner structure and outside structure take place relative movement appears very easily, inner structure and outside structure rotation desynchrony promptly, are unfavorable for using under powerful condition.

Detailed Description
In order to make the objects, technical solutions and advantages of the present invention more apparent, the present invention will be described in detail with reference to the accompanying drawings.
As shown in figures 1-3, the utility model provides a high-power motor commutator, which comprises a housing 1, a trapezoidal groove 7 is arranged on the outer side of the housing 1, a fixed backing plate 5 is arranged on the outer side of the trapezoidal groove 7, a commutator segment 6 is fixedly connected on the outer side of the fixed backing plate 5, a metal bushing 3 is fixedly connected on the inner side of the housing 1, a spacing column 4 is fixedly connected on the inner side of the metal bushing 3, two ends of the spacing column 4 are provided with baffle plates 8, a heat insulation pad 13 is arranged on the inner side of the spacing column 4, a fixed pin 9 is fixedly connected on the outer side of the spacing column 4, a reinforcing frame 10 is arranged on the inner side of the housing 1, a matching round head 2 is fixedly connected on the inner side of the commutator segment 6, a mica sheet 11 is fixedly connected on the outer side of the commutator segment 6, the whole device can prevent the commutator segment 6 from deforming under high-speed operation, can make, the device is prevented from being damaged, and the relative displacement between the limiting column and the shell under high-speed operation can be prevented.
As shown in fig. 1, the fitting round head 2 is fitted and connected with the metal bush 3, so that the metal bush 3 and the casing can keep running synchronously.
Furthermore, the baffle plate 8 is in contact connection with two sides of the commutator segment 6, and the fixing of the commutator segment 6 is further enhanced.
Furthermore, the fixing pin 9 penetrates into the inside of the housing 1, and the fixing pin 9 is in interference fit with the housing 1, so that the fixing is more sufficient, and the fixing pin 9 is prevented from falling off.
It should be noted that the reinforcing frame 10 is shaped like a Chinese character 'ji', and the reinforcing frame 10 is in contact connection with the cylindrical surface of the limiting column 4, so that the connection between the housing 1 and the metal bush 3 is more tight.
It should be noted that, the matching holes 12 are provided at the two ends of the limiting column 4, and the fixing pin 9 is in interference fit with the matching holes 12, so that the limiting column 4 is conveniently connected with the casing 1 through the fixing pin 9.
Specifically, the two ends of the reinforcing frame 10 abut against the fixed backing plate 5, so that a gap is prevented from being formed between the commutator segment 6 and the housing 1 due to a large centrifugal force.
